当前位置: 首页 > 前端开发

     前端开发
         450人感兴趣  ●  1881次引用
  • 深入理解CSS后代选择器:解决嵌套元素样式不生效问题

    深入理解CSS后代选择器:解决嵌套元素样式不生效问题

    本文旨在解决CSS样式不生效的常见问题,特别是当样式应用于嵌套HTML元素时。通过解析错误的CSS选择器组合方式,重点讲解如何正确使用后代选择器(即空格组合器)来精确匹配目标元素。教程将提供详细的HTML和CSS示例,帮助开发者避免选择器陷阱,确保样式能够按预期生效,提升前端开发效率和代码质量。

    html教程 4692025-10-22 09:59:23

  • 如何为当前导航栏元素添加“活动”类:JavaScript事件委托实践

    如何为当前导航栏元素添加“活动”类:JavaScript事件委托实践

    本教程详细讲解如何利用JavaScript为网页导航栏的当前活动链接添加并管理“active”类。文章首先指出直接操作DOM可能遇到的常见问题,如语法错误和状态管理不当,随后引入并演示了更高效、更具扩展性的事件委托(EventDelegation)模式,确保导航状态的正确切换和代码的健壮性,同时提供完整的HTML、CSS和JavaScript实现。

    html教程 2362025-10-22 09:30:01

  • 如何使用 CSS 将文本置于 Div 的左上角

    如何使用 CSS 将文本置于 Div 的左上角

    本文旨在解决如何使用CSS将文本内容精准地放置在绝对定位的div容器的左上角。通过设置line-height属性,可以有效控制文本的行高,使其与字体大小相匹配,从而实现文本的顶部对齐。同时,避免使用固定负边距,以适应不同字体大小的需求。

    html教程 7992025-10-22 09:26:37

  • HTML/CSS/JS:实现按钮控制表格显示与隐藏的实用教程

    HTML/CSS/JS:实现按钮控制表格显示与隐藏的实用教程

    本教程详细讲解如何通过HTML结构调整和JavaScript逻辑优化,实现一个按钮来控制表格的显示与隐藏。我们将解决按钮位置不当和表格初始状态未隐藏的问题,确保按钮位于表格上方,并且表格在页面加载时默认隐藏,仅在点击按钮后才显示。

    html教程 8022025-10-22 09:21:46

  • 解决JavaScript无法更新页面元素值的常见原因:DOM加载时序

    解决JavaScript无法更新页面元素值的常见原因:DOM加载时序

    本文探讨了JavaScript尝试修改尚未加载的HTML元素值时遇到的常见问题。核心原因在于脚本在目标DOM元素渲染之前执行,导致document.getElementById无法找到目标元素。解决方案是确保脚本在目标元素之后执行,或者利用DOM内容加载事件来安全地执行操作,以保证JavaScript操作的有效性。

    html教程 8522025-10-22 09:11:00

  • Composer与NPM/Yarn在PHP项目中如何协同工作?

    Composer与NPM/Yarn在PHP项目中如何协同工作?

    Composer负责PHP后端依赖管理,NPM/Yarn管理前端资源,两者协同工作:Composer处理PHP库和自动加载,NPM/Yarn安装JavaScript库并运行构建工具,典型流程中先用composer创建项目,再通过npm初始化前端、安装依赖并构建静态资源,最终由PHP模板引入编译后的文件,建议在package.json中定义脚本并在CI或部署流程中先后执行composerinstall与npm构建命令,保持职责清晰以实现高效集成。

    composer 5842025-10-22 08:56:02

  • VSCode前端:Sass/SCSS开发配置

    VSCode前端:Sass/SCSS开发配置

    安装Sass相关插件并配置LiveSassCompiler,可实现SCSS实时编译与浏览器自动刷新。1.安装Sass、LiveSassCompiler、SCSSIntelliSense和PathIntellisense插件;2.在settings.json中设置输出格式、保存路径及排除目录;3.点击“WatchSass”启动编译,配合LiveServer实现页面热更新;4.启用Emmet、设置默认格式化工具并开启保存自动格式化以提升编码体验。

    VSCode 6282025-10-22 08:51:02

  • Chrome浏览器官网首页入口 谷歌浏览器网页版登录

    Chrome浏览器官网首页入口 谷歌浏览器网页版登录

    Chrome浏览器官网首页入口地址是https://www.google.com/intl/zh-CN/chrome/,该页面提供Chrome浏览器的下载服务及核心功能介绍,包括快速稳定的浏览体验、多标签页管理、安全防护、智能搜索、现代网页技术兼容;支持个性化设置如主题自定义、扩展程序添加、数据同步和开发者工具;具备跨平台特性,可在Windows、macOS、Linux及移动端使用,实现账号互通、数据协同与离线访问。

    浏览器 7862025-10-21 21:45:01

  • VSCode集成浏览器:实时预览网页

    VSCode集成浏览器:实时预览网页

    安装LiveServer插件是实现在VSCode中实时预览网页的最常用方法,通过右键HTML文件选择“OpenwithLiveServer”或点击右下角“GoLive”按钮启动本地服务器,页面将在默认浏览器中打开并支持保存后自动刷新;若需在编辑器内预览,可使用PreviewInBrowser等插件,但功能有限;建议配置默认浏览器和打开路径以优化体验,结合Sass、TypeScript等工具实现全流程热更新,提升前端开发效率。

    VSCode 5952025-10-21 21:31:01

  • html函数如何构建导航菜单栏 html函数列表与链接的组合应用

    html函数如何构建导航菜单栏 html函数列表与链接的组合应用

    使用HTML列表和链接标签构建语义化导航菜单,配合CSS实现样式与布局,通过JavaScript增强交互,支持多级下拉,提升可访问性与用户体验。

    html教程 2472025-10-21 18:09:02

  • JavaScript热模块替换机制

    JavaScript热模块替换机制

    HMR通过构建工具监听文件变化并推送更新,实现模块热替换。1.启动时建立WebSocket连接;2.监听文件变更触发增量构建;3.推送补丁包至浏览器;4.客户端调用module.hot.accept处理更新;5.React用react-refresh、Vue由vue-loader支持、Vite通过import.meta.hot实现高效HMR。

    js教程 2152025-10-21 17:42:02

  • mac上面怎么写html5_Mac系统HTML5开发工具链

    mac上面怎么写html5_Mac系统HTML5开发工具链

    Mac系统原生支持HTML5开发,无需复杂配置,配合文本编辑器和现代浏览器即可预览;2.推荐使用VSCode、SublimeText或WebStorm提升编码效率;3.借助浏览器DevTools、本地服务器、Git及构建工具完善开发流程;4.利用Safari开发菜单或真机测试响应式布局与PWA应用,实现高效跨设备调试。

    html教程 7982025-10-21 16:55:01

  • html5就业怎么样_HTML5就业前景与薪资水平分析

    html5就业怎么样_HTML5就业前景与薪资水平分析

    HTML5就业需结合岗位、城市与个人能力,纯H5岗位减少但技术仍广泛应用于移动端、小程序和混合开发,企业更看重综合能力,要求掌握Vue/React、小程序开发及跨端框架,薪资因地区和经验差异大,一线及新一线城市机会更多,入行者应提升框架熟练度、项目经验与全栈视野,高级开发者月薪可达23.9K,核心竞争力在于用H5解决实际业务问题。

    html教程 2582025-10-21 16:53:01

  • HTML复选框怎么使用_HTML checkbox多选框实现与取值方法

    HTML复选框怎么使用_HTML checkbox多选框实现与取值方法

    复选框用于多选场景,通过name属性分组,value传递值,checked设默认选中,JavaScript用querySelectorAll获取选中值,提交时仅选中的项发送数据。

    html教程 4322025-10-21 14:49:01

  • css如何用@import实现模块化样式

    css如何用@import实现模块化样式

    使用@import可实现CSS模块化,通过引入base、layout等样式文件拆分功能,并支持媒体查询条件加载,但存在性能与阻塞问题,建议简单项目使用,大型项目优选构建工具或CSS预处理器方案。

    css教程 1532025-10-21 14:35:01

  • html5是什么怎么读_HTML5技术定义与正确发音

    html5是什么怎么读_HTML5技术定义与正确发音

    HTML5是超文本标记语言第五版,由W3C和WHATWG共同推动,新增语义标签、原生音视频支持、Canvas图形绘制、增强表单及JavaScriptAPI,实现跨平台网页应用开发,标准读作aitch-tee-em-elfive。

    html教程 6652025-10-21 14:11:02

热门阅读

关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号